[quote=Anonymous]If you can afford it, I highly recommend a passport expediting company. It is $250 extra. For my DS, since someone needs to witness you sign the form and accept the materials, we just did a walk in appointment at MLK library in D.C. where there is a State Dept Passport desk - they took the photo there for us for $15 and charged a $35 processing fee. They can accept your forms and other documents and send for processing (where you have to wait weeks) or they can hand everything back to you in a sealed envelope and you send to the expedite company which guarantees your passport within 5-7 days. We are not flying until August but did not want to deal with the hassle. While we could have tried to get an appointment within 2 weeks of travel, we didn't want to risk it and also didn't want to take DS out of camp for the day and both of us miss work. The extra $250 is totally worth it! You still pay the State Dept expedite fee, but the $250 on top is a small price to pay if you don't want to wait weeks/months.[/quote]
